The cross-sectional area of a solenoid with an iron core is 10 cm^2. Find the magnetic permeability of the core material under such conditions when the magnetic flux penetrating the cross-sectional area of the solenoid is 1.4 * 10^-3 Wb. Find what strength of current flowing through the solenoid this magnetic flux corresponds to, if it is known that the inductance of the solenoid under these conditions is 0.44 H. The length of the solenoid is 1 m.
